回 帖 发 新 帖 刷新版面

主题:asp语法错误 (操作符丢失)

这是一个留言本的删除页面,在本地浏览的时候就出现下面(操作符丢失)的错误。其他页面还有一个共同的错误(无效字符那两行),也不知道它们之间有没有联系。请大家帮忙看下,偶太菜了。
无效字符
sql="select * from main"
-------------------------------------
Microsoft JET Database Engine (0x80040E14)
语法错误 (操作符丢失) 在查询表达式 'id=' 中。
/ban/del.asp, 第 6 行

代码:
1  <!--#include file="conn.asp"-->
2  <%
3  set rs=server.createobject("adodb.recordset")
4  id=request.querystring("id")
5  sql="select * from main where id="&id
6  rs.open sql,conn,2,3      
7  rs.delete
8  rs.update
9  rs.close
   set rs=nothing
   conn.close
   set conn=nothing
   %>

回复列表 (共5个回复)

沙发

request.querystring("id") 没有取到值,看一下传入值是不是有问题!

板凳

<a href="del.asp?id=<%=rs("id")%>" onClick="return confirm('是否删除本留言?');">删除</a>

这个不知道有错误吗。。

3 楼


正确!

4 楼


[em8]大家帮忙看看这代码到底哪里出错的,小弟太菜,实在不知道怎么办。。
如果还有用到的代码,我再贴出来。

5 楼

呵~~~~~~~
同意2 楼 


[url=http://www.2qqface.com.cn/]http://www.2qqface.com.cn/[/url] 
[url=http://www.mzit.com/]http://www.mzit.com/[/url]
[url=http://www.yidu35.com/]http://www.yidu35.com/[/url]
[url=http://www.yidu35.cn/]http://www.yidu35.cn/[/url]
[url=http://www.yidu35.net/]http://www.yidu35.net/[/url]
[url=http://www.yahucn.com/]http://www.yahucn.com/[/url]
[url=http://www.xtc2c.com/]http://www.xtc2c.com/[/url]
[url=http://www.kc35.com.cn/]http://www.kc35.com.cn/[/url]

我来回复

您尚未登录,请登录后再回复。点此登录或注册